Sixteen teams have registered to participate in the Kwara State Beach Soccer Championship scheduled to commence on October 26 in Ilorin.
Construction work and spreading of the beach sand are on going at the pitch site inside the State Stadium, Ilorin as at the time our correspondent visited the place.
Speaking with our correspondent, the Project Coordinator, Saraki Rasheed, said the championship that would end on October 29, is to encourage the brand in the State.
The Beach Soccer Ambassador, Isiaka Olawale, who was also on ground, commended the initiative and the support so far receive from the government.
Olawale, who is the Captain of the Nation’s Sand Eagles, called on the people to take the advantage to develop their talents.
